Blunder 1: Absolutely No Location based Directory Listings

Neglecting to establish a solid online presence is a significant error for companies, with a substantial contributor to this issue being the lack of accurate and up-to-date location based directory site listings. By not having your company listed in internet directories like Google My Business, Yelp, and Bing Places, you're essentially hiding from possible clients. This can result in a 70% decline in internet visibility and a significant loss of future customers. Virtually half of all Google searches are driven by location based intent, highlighting the significance for businesses to develop a robust online visibility in local directory sites.

Accurate online listings are essential for location based search optimization.Inconsist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one Number) information throughout different on-line platforms can confuse search engines and adversely impact location based search rankings.

Optimizing your online visibility with precise and consistent listings can significantly enhance your business's exposure, increasing its opportunities of appearing in the desired local pack by approximately 30%. An essential your organization listings throughout various on-line platforms can have an extensive impact on your online track record and attract even more consumers to your doorstep.

Mistake 2: Improper Category Selection

Wrong category selection can result in a 41% decline in search engine positions and a 20% decrease in web page web traffic.
It can likewise bring about a loss of visibility in location based search results, as Google's algorithm focuses on businesses with correct and applicable categories. To boost your positioning, select features that properly represent your company and target market, such as "women-led" or "LGBTQ+ friendly".

Consistently assessing and updating your category choice can additionally impact your location based online search engine rankings and on the internet exposure.

Mistake 3: Poor Review Response

Effective customer review managing is critical not only for establishing trustworthiness with consumers, and also for affecting your Google ranking. As a matter of fact, on-line write-ups account for nearly a fifth of the elements that establish location based Google rankings. Furthermore, neglecting adverse responses can have serious consequences, as almost fifty percent of customers are a lot more likely to support a business that actively addresses and reacts to objection.

Paying no attention to adverse reviews can harm a company's on-line credibility, as 85% of customers trust in online customer reviews as much as individual recommendations. To enhance location based search engine optimization and raise consumer engagement, carry out an evaluation management approach that invites consumers to leave write-ups and responds promptly to both positive and negative reviews.

Verify that your Google My Business listing is up-to-date and that you're showcasing reviews on your site, as 64% of consumers state they're most likely to rely on a company with customer evaluations on its web site.

Problem 5: Wrong NAP Information

Developing an uniform digital impact is essential for location based services, and it begins with making certain that their company name, address, and contact number are constantly listed across the internet. Inconsistencies in this information can create trouble among online search engines and potential consumers, ultimately resulting in reduced online visibility and less site visitors. Research study from Moz reveals that incorrect business listings can have a substantial effect, with a staggering 41% decrease in search engine positionings for businesses with erroneous or inconsistent on line visibility. Prevent this error by continually inspecting your organization's name, address and telephone number (NAP) details on different online networks, such as Google My Business listings, web directory sites and your business's main site.

To make sure consistency and accuracy and precision, utilize citation monitoring tools such as Moz Local, BrightLocal, or Whitespark to keep an eye on and update on-line listings, rectifying any type of disparities in your company's name, address and contact number (NAP) data. It's vital to maintain harmony across all platforms, consisting of standardized format of addresses and phone numbers, to avoid potential confusion and mistakes.

Standardizing your service's name, address, and phone number (NAP) across the internet can increase location based search engine positions by as high as 15%, research by BrightLocal exposes. Making certain NAP consistency and accuracy is critical for developing depend on with potential clients and stopping missed chances. To make best use of online exposure, consistently review and fine-tune your NAP information to ensure precise depiction in search engine results.
